SummaryThe global Threat Detection Systems Market is estimated to be valued at USD 211.3 billion in 2026 and is expected to grow at a CAGR of 15% to reach USD 648.5 billion by 2034.Market OverviewThreat detection systems are designed to identify and alert against potential threats, ranging from physical intrusions and cyberattacks to hazardous materials and biological agents. These systems are becoming increasingly crucial for protecting individuals, businesses, and critical infrastructure across a wide range of sectors, including airports, government facilities, corporate offices, and industrial sites. The market has witnessed significant advancements in recent years, with the development of new technologies, improved detection capabilities, and expanded applications that meet the growing need for effective security solutions. In 2025, the threat detection systems market has seen a surge in demand, driven by the increasing sophistication of threats and the growing awareness of security vulnerabilities. This has spurred innovation in the development of advanced technologies, including artificial intelligence (AI), machine learning (ML), and sensor fusion, enhancing the accuracy, speed, and reliability of threat detection. Looking ahead to 2026, the market is expected to witness continued growth, fueled by the evolving nature of threats and the increasing need for robust security measures across various industries and sectors. Latest TrendsNavigating a Complex World of Risks Technology InnovationLeveraging Advanced Capabilities Artificial Intelligence (AI) and Machine Learning (ML)The integration of AI and ML into threat detection systems enhances their ability to analyze data, learn from patterns, and identify threats in real time. Sensor FusionCombining data from multiple sensors, such as cameras, thermal imaging devices, and acoustic sensors, improves the accuracy and reliability of threat detection. Biometric AuthenticationThe use of biometrics, such as facial recognition, iris scanning, and fingerprint analysis, offers a more secure and convenient method for identity verification. Expanding ApplicationsProtecting Diverse Environments CybersecurityThreat detection systems are playing a crucial role in cybersecurity, identifying and mitigating cyberattacks, data breaches, and other online threats. Critical InfrastructureThese systems are used to protect critical infrastructure, such as power grids, water treatment plants, and transportation systems, from physical threats and cyberattacks. HealthcareThreat detection systems are being deployed in healthcare settings to enhance security, prevent theft, and ensure the safety of patients and staff. RetailThreat detection systems are used in retail stores to prevent theft, shoplifting, and other security risks. DriversFueling Growth and Innovation Evolving ThreatsResponding to a Changing Landscape Cybersecurity ThreatsThe evolving nature of cyber threats, including ransomware attacks, phishing scams, and sophisticated malware, is driving the demand for advanced threat detection systems. Physical Security ThreatsThe increasing prevalence of terrorism, organized crime, and other physical security threats is driving the adoption of advanced threat detection technologies. Emerging ThreatsThe emergence of new threats, such as drone attacks, biological weapons, and other unconventional threats, is prompting the development of innovative threat detection solutions. Government RegulationsMandating Enhanced Security Compliance RequirementsGovernment regulations and compliance standards are driving the adoption of threat detection systems in various sectors, particularly in areas like transportation, healthcare, and critical infrastructure. Security StandardsThe establishment of higher security standards and best practices is increasing the demand for advanced threat detection technologies and solutions. ChallengesNavigating a Complex Landscape Cost and ComplexityBalancing Performance with Economics High Investment CostsImplementing advanced threat detection systems can involve significant capital investment, particularly for organizations with large-scale security requirements. Technical ComplexityThe operation and maintenance of advanced threat detection systems can be technically complex, requiring specialized training and expertise. False PositivesOptimizing Accuracy and Efficiency Minimizing False AlarmsBalancing the need for high detection accuracy with minimizing false alarms is a significant challenge for threat detection systems, particularly in high-traffic environments. Improving Detection AlgorithmsOngoing research and development are focused on improving detection algorithms and reducing false positives, enhancing the effectiveness and efficiency of threat detection systems.
